Embodiment 1

[0017] Red grape cultivation method, comprises the following steps:

[0018] a. Select red grape seeds to be implanted in the soil for propagation. When the grape seedlings are unearthed, layer them. After 3 months, the pressed branches are cut off from the mother plant and transplanted to other places. Simultaneously, increase the fertilizer to make the flower buds differentiate well;

[0019] b. Before planting, dig a ditch with a width of 0.3 meters and a depth of 0.3 meters. Transplant seedlings on both sides of the ditch, 800 seedlings per mu, spread straw around the seedlings, pour enough water on the roots of the seedlings, and apply pig manure and superphosphate In the ditch, the application rate of pig manure is 500 kg per mu, and the application rate of superphosphate is 200 kg per mu;

Abstract

The invention discloses a red grape planting method. The method includes that ditches are digged before planting, seedlings are transplanted on two sides of each ditch, straw is laid around the seedlings, enough water is irrigated at the root of each the seedling, and pig manure and calcium superphosphate are applied in the ditches; when the heights of the seedlings exceed 0.5m and the outdoor temperature is smaller than 10 DEG C, a greenhouse needs to be set up, the greenhouse is covered by straw curtains in the daytime, ventilation windows are opened at night, and a low-temperature and dark environment can promote dormancy; 25-40 days later, germination accelerating measures are taken, mulching films are covered on the ground, and greenhouse temperature-increasing leavening agent is placed in the greenhouse to stimulate germination; from germination to flowering, ventilation should be maintained in the greenhouse, pesticide should be sprayed 2-3 times each week, and in a flowering phase, several side branches without flowering are trimmed. When the heights of the seedlings exceed 0.5m and the outdoor temperature is smaller than 10 DEG C, temperature is low, and the seedlings need dormancy, so that the greenhouse is covered by the straw curtains in the daytime and the ventilation windows are opened at night to build the low-temperature and dark environment; in the process of germination accelerating, after the greenhouse temperature-increasing leavening agent is added, air temperature and ground temperature are increased, so that flowering and fruiting in advance can be realized and picking time can be brought forward by 30 and more days.

Description

technical field [0001] The invention relates to a method for cultivating red grapes. It belongs to the field of agricultural planting. Background technique [0002] In viticultural management techniques, the plant spacing is too close, the soil layer arrangement is unreasonable, the efficiency of irrigation and fertilization is low, and the grape yield is not high. After the leaves are injured by the first frost in autumn, they must be forced to sleep, otherwise budding will be affected. After budding, due to the external temperature If you use multi-layer greenhouse coverage to increase the temperature, it will affect the daylight, or use electric heating wires to heat, and waste energy.
